While it looks good on your resume to have these kind of jobs listed as work experience, you should count the cost before you step in to fill such a role.The first things you need to do when considering joining a bank is ask yourself why. Spend time researching the roles, the companies and the sector. How do you see the challenges the banking sector is facing evolving over the next 12 months? How do your skills help the company face those challenges? Make friends and keep in touch with previous university and work colleagues. Make a spreadsheet with an action plan of you emailing or calling them regularly. It does not need to be every week, not even every month. Once a quarter is fine unless you have anything specific to discuss. Just say “Hi, wanted to know how you job/course/whatever is going, etc”. Show you are genuinely interested in them and not just calling asking for a job.Draft a CV and a cover letter specially for each one of them.Are you joining them for the money? Are you joining them because they are a good brand name? Are you joining them because the market is down and you have nowhere else to turn?
